Navigating Acute Heart Failure Diagnosis
This chapter explores the diagnostic challenges of acute congestive heart failure, focusing on patients with wheezing and the impact of bronchodilators. It evaluates the role of BNP and NT-proBNP as biomarkers in differentiating heart failure from other conditions while addressing the limitations of these tests. The conversation also emphasizes the importance of combining clinical judgment with biomarker data for improved diagnostic accuracy in emergency medicine.
